  • Patent number: 10290269
    Abstract: An LCD includes a 2-D array of pixels including at least one transmissive light modulator including a first light modulation signal input, and at least one reflective light modulator including a second light modulation signal input, a processor configured to provide a plurality of images to a display driver; and a display driver configured to provide the plurality of images to the 2-D array of pixels, wherein the display driver provides a first image frame to the transmissive light modulator, wherein the display driver provides a second image frame to the reflective light modulator; wherein the display driver provides a first image frame to the transmissive light modulator, wherein the display driver provides a second image frame to the reflective light modulator, and wherein the first image frame is displayed by the transmissive light modulator at the same time the second image frame is displayed by the reflective light modulator.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 29, 2016
    Date of Patent: May 14, 2019
    Assignee: Motorola Mobility LLC
    Inventors: Eric D Berdinis, Toshihiro Fujimura, Sen Yang
